UltraCore® 121K3M-H Plus Flux-Cored (FCAW-G) Wire, 0.052 in, 33 lb Spool, is designed for high-strength welding on low-alloy steels in heavy-duty industrial applications. This flux-cored wire delivers exceptional arc stability, minimal spatter, and smooth slag removal for clean, high-quality welds. Ideal for structural welding, fabrication, and repair, the 121K3M-H Plus ensures deep weld penetration and high-strength results. Whether working indoors or outdoors, this wire offers consistent, reliable performance in demanding environments, making it the perfect choice for professionals seeking durable, efficient welds in a wide range of industries.
Details:
Innovative design capable of superior toughness at-60° F
